The modern war is a high-tech war and the conventional methods of designing and evaluating the underwater fuze are not adaptive to it. So the classical research ways must be refreshed. The technology of emulation and virtual prototype is employed to adjust to the underwater fuze study today.So the virtual design of the detonator based on database is inevitable. As the database have powerful inquiry and data processing functions, high efficient data support and intelligent expression capability of the experts are supplied and the whole process of virtual design can be implemented on the computer. This helps us increase the design efficiency and reduce the error. It is convenient to find the problems existed through the virtual test at the start of the design. It can implement the interaction between users and design by the virtual environment at the middle. At the end it prove the principles such as the reliability of the design by the technology of the virtual emulation and analyze the aspects of dynamics, control, electromagnetic interference, reliability and security.The main content of this paper is how to acquire data validly, efficiently during the design process. A method for database model is put forward in the paper by combining the virtual design technology with the structure problem of integration database. The total design proposal is given at the foundation of the function request, feasibility assessment and data flow analysis of the underwater detonator design with the database system. Meanwhile, the implement technology of the system is studied in detail. It includes the establishment of bottom database, the lead of the safe model of the database system and the access interface, inquiry module, the data processing module of the physical field of the warship, the on-line help file of the system etc..The final database system have characteristics of high practicability, good expandability, feasible data inquiry , the output of the universal data report, complete parameters, large amount of information and high security. The establishment of the database system lays foundation for the research of the virtual prototype and environment of underwater fuze. It also plays an important role for the optimum design, performance test and evaluation in the design process. Meanwhile, the database system may help to shorten the development period, raise design level, and economize devotion funds. Its economic performance and military meaning can be very considerable and may have an extensive military application.
